Funding African Entrepreneurs

This was an interesting article written by Loren Treisman of the Indigo Foundation, a grant-making foundation that funds technology-driven projects that seek to bring about social change in Africa.
Do African Entrepreneurs Need Charity?


In the main, I agree with the premise of her piece, articulated around three main points:

- Information technology is key to realizing the full potential of developing economies, especially in bringing about the reforms required to spark said economies.

- The best solutions to Africa's challenges are likely to come from the communities affected by them; a completely different development paradigm to what has obtained historically.

- Investment is required to make these enterprises and start-ups self-sustaining and drive them towards their stated goals.
